Washington Code 84.34.250 – Nonprofit nature conservancy corporation or association defined

As used in RCW 84.34.210, as now or hereafter amended, RCW 84.34.220, as now or hereafter amended, and *RCW 79A.15.010, “nonprofit nature conservancy corporation or association” means an organization which qualifies as being tax exempt under 26 U.S.C. § 501(c) (of the Internal Revenue Code) as it exists on June 25, 1976 and one which has as one of its principal purposes the conducting or facilitating of scientific research; the conserving of natural resources, including but not limited to biological resources, for the general public; or the conserving of open spaces, including but not limited to wildlife habitat to be utilized as public access areas, for the use and enjoyment of the general public.
[ 2009 c 341 § 6; 1975-’76 2nd ex.s. c 22 § 4.]
NOTES:
*Reviser’s note: RCW 79A.15.010 was amended by 2016 c 149 § 2, changing the term “nonprofit nature conservancy corporation or association” to “nonprofit nature conservancies.”
